  <abstract>This thesis studies the selective maintenance policy based on the ages of the components in the system. After a fixed operation time period, the system will be maintained in a short period before the next operation cycle. In the fixed maintenance period, the replacement with identical item, the replacement with upgraded item, the rehabilitation or doing nothing actions will be chosen for each component of the system. In operation period, if the machines fail, they will be minimally repaired immediately to restore the working condition.  The mathematical models are proposed to maximize the availability and the reliability of the system under the constraints of maintenance time and budget. The models are developed for the serial system, the parallel system and the serial-parallel system. The illustrating examples of the availability-maximization models are solved by using Lingo program and compared with the results coming from @Risk Optimizer program. The numerical examples of reliability-maximization models are solved by using @Risk Optimizer program.  This research also extends the study on the multi-cycle selective maintenance policy with the maximin model and cost-minimization model. In these models, the system is considered in a planning horizon with a predefined number of cycles and the budget is set for all cycles. The numerical examples are also investigated by using @Risk Optimizer program.</abstract>
